Table Of ContentForeword Roger Wagner Preface Author's Note Chapter 1: Why Teach Programming in the Primary Grades? Chapter 2: What Can We Learn Through Programming? Chapter 3: Offline Programming and the Power of Dance to Develop Logic Chapter 4: Programming for Pre-readers Chapter 5: Blockly-based App Programming Chapter 6: Scratch and Other Web-based Programming Platforms Chapter 7: Learning with Robots; Lesson Design in Three Dimensions Chapter 8: Programming to Learn Social Skills Chapter 9: Programming to Learn to Read Chapter 10: Programming to Learn in Elementary STEM Chapter 11: Resources and Quick-Start Lesson Ideas Acknowledgments About the Author Index
SynopsisProgramming in the Primary Grades demystifies teaching core content through programming. Without becoming a step by step guide, the text helps teachers visualize and implement learning activities that build on the engagement and excitement students' experience when they are programming. While the focus of the book is programming, it isn't about the technology. Dr. Patterson helps teachers visualize and plan engaging and empowering lessons that use programming as a way for students to share their developing understanding of a subject.
